Ka Mabuza Auto Mechanic
Khumbula
Features
Map
Similar companies
Electronics store
Zondi Auto Electrical
N1, Sefene, 0812
0727415275
Electronics store
Quality Aluminium Home Improvements
Jan Smuts St, Hartswater, 8570
Electronics store
MFO Interconnect
1203 Ben Swart St, Moregloed, Pretoria, 0186
+27798681786
Electronics store
One World Tracking (Pty) Ltd
477 Pretoria Rd, Silverton, Pretoria, 0184
+27825440599